User Tips / Usage Guide
- Wall Pre-check: Ensure the wall is structurally sound and capable of supporting the cat tree's weight. Use a stud finder to locate and secure into wall joists for maximum stability.
- Tools Required: Gather all necessary tools, including a drill and level, before beginning the installation to ensure smooth assembly.
- Platform Arrangement: Consider your cat's agility and size when arranging the platforms; adjustable configurations can cater to novice climbers and seasoned jumpers alike.
- Regular Maintenance: Rotate the sisal posts regularly to utilize all sides evenly, extending the product's life.
- Engagement Enhancement: Place catnip or favorite toys on varying levels to encourage climbing and playing.
- Gradual Introduction: Introduce the cat tree to your pet gradually to allow them time to explore and get accustomed to the new environment.
- Clean-Up: Periodically check and clean the felt platforms to maintain hygiene and prevent dust accumulation.
